The team you'll be part of
You will be joining a highly skilled R&D Software team within Nokia's Microwave Business Unit. We are a leader in delivering 5G microwave backhauling solutions, leveraging cutting-edge technologies like O-RAN and vRAN (Open Radio Access Network and Virtualized Radio Access Network).
Our team is responsible for developing and integrating software for a range of microwave equipment, incorporating both network and radio boards.
We are part of a larger Mobile Networks Business Group that is a pioneer in wireless mobility networks, holding over 3,500 patent families essential for 5G.

Key Skills And Experience
You have:
* A Bachelor's degree or an HTI Diploma in SW Engineering or equivalent
* No prior work experience required, but a strong foundation in software development principles and a demonstrated passion for software engineering are essential.
* Fluency in C/C++ implementation (embedded) on Linux, with particular focus to Secure Coding guidelines.
* Embedded SW development skills: multi-core processing, limited resources usage, remote debug capabilities.
Expected technical competencies:
* Basic Knowledge of Ethernet and IP and secured protocols.
* Knowledge on iterative and incremental process.
* Basic practice on the use of GIT as Configuration management.
* In general, a solid knowledge on tools and methodologies used to design, version, review, unit test, and troubleshoot the SW.
* Nice to have some knowledge on continuous integration tools (Jenkins).
